The Rise of Coastal Minimalism in Architecture
Minimalism isn’t new, but its coastal interpretation is evolving. Coastal minimalism draws inspiration from the beachside environment—think clean lines, muted tones, raw materials, and light-filled open spaces. In the Northern Beaches, this approach feels particularly fitting. It respects the landscape, encourages indoor-outdoor living, and reflects the region’s relaxed pace.
Coastal homes today are designed to feel like an extension of the environment. Builders are using materials like timber, stone, concrete, and linen, creating homes that blend seamlessly into their surroundings. Oversized glass panels replace traditional windows, allowing the views to do the talking while letting in natural light and ocean breezes.
Homes in areas like Avalon, Newport, and Bilgola are increasingly being rebuilt or renovated with these principles in mind. Large, airy spaces, subtle luxury details, and a “less is more” approach have become the go-to for discerning homeowners.
How Northern Beaches Builders Are Leading the Change
The shift toward coastal minimalism wouldn’t be possible without the Northern Beaches builders who understand the delicate balance between design, function, and place.
What sets these builders apart isn’t just craftsmanship—it’s an intimate understanding of the local lifestyle and environment. Building by the sea comes with its own set of challenges—wind exposure, salt corrosion, shifting topography—but also endless opportunities for creative, thoughtful design.
In response, many Northern Beaches builder firms are collaborating closely with architects and interior designers to create homes that are not only beautiful but also sustainable and long-lasting. This includes:
- Smart orientation for passive solar design
- Use of recycled and local materials
- Seamless integration of indoor and outdoor spaces
- Energy-efficient glazing and insulation systems
- Custom joinery and fine-tuned finishes that emphasize quality over quantity
Builders are also increasingly adopting sustainable practices, such as low-VOC materials, water-saving systems, and solar energy solutions, aligning with homeowners' desire for eco-conscious yet elegant living.
Design Elements Defining the New Coastal Luxury
So, what does coastal minimalism actually look like in practice? Step into a newly built home in the Northern Beaches today, and you’ll likely find:
Neutral, Earthy Palettes:
Whites, sands, soft greys, and warm wood tones dominate interiors. These hues mimic the natural surroundings—from driftwood to dune grasses—and create a calming, cohesive visual flow.
Organic Materials:
Raw timber beams, polished concrete floors, and natural stone benchtops are not only visually appealing but also deeply tactile. These materials age beautifully, developing character over time.
Natural Light & Ventilation:
Builders design with light and air in mind. High ceilings, clerestory windows, and wide sliding doors are all common features in coastal minimalist homes.
Functional Simplicity:
Storage is often hidden behind sleek joinery, and every element serves a purpose. This results in uncluttered, serene interiors where the focus shifts to the surrounding views and relaxed lifestyle.

Case Study: Palm Beach Transformation
Take the recent transformation of a 1970s weatherboard home in Palm Beach. Once outdated and dark, the property was stripped back to its bones and rebuilt by a local Northern Beaches builder into a stunning example of coastal minimalism.
White-rendered walls, floor-to-ceiling glass doors, and a floating timber staircase gave the home an instant modern edge. The interior featured a neutral palette, custom joinery, and natural textures, all designed to let the ocean view take center stage.
The outdoor space, previously underused, was redesigned into an alfresco living zone with a plunge pool, outdoor kitchen, and retractable roof—offering the perfect example of modern coastal living.
